Department: Information Technology (IMT)

Reports to: IT Planning Manager/IT Planning Lead

This is accountable for planning, continuous productivity improvement and provide analytical insights across IT department.

Key responsibilities:

* Provide enterprise level view of department cost and trend

* Provide enterprise level view of department resource consumption and trend

* Prepare IT performance updates and provide analytical insights to senior management

* Plan and support the departmental budget and forecast processes in different type of IT projects

* Monitor and keep track of department initiatives such as Enhancements and Scheduled Maintenance projects

* Work with Infra Managers, Application Managers, Project Managers and Performance Managers to facilitate management reporting in relation to department cost and Analytics

* Support development of Service agreements with subsidiaries and review Terms and Conditions.

* Provide impact assessment on BAU cost brought by implemented projects

* Drive continuous productivity improvement through automating and streamlining processes

* Develop and share with fellow team members capability to provide in-depth analysis and business insight

* Provide enterprise level view of department space management

* Support miscellaneous office overhead for department

* Act as subject matter expert to contribute to other initiatives and projects specific analytics

Requirements:

* University Degree in analytical discipline – such as Computer Science, Information Systems or related disciplines

* Minimum 4 years of working experience with at least recent 2 years in related position.

* Strong analytical and problem solving skills.

* Good business acumen, with demonstrable competency in business planning, cost/resource management and strategy implementer.

* Good numerical skills, ability to derive and understand the stories behind numbers and be able to drive improvement. Project accounting experience is preferred.

* Good interpersonal skills in areas such as teamwork, facilitation and negotiation

* Good communications abilities and relationship management skills
